How much does it cost to rent a home in Honolulu?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Honolulu 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,491 | $1,695 | $9,000 |
| Honolulu 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,345 | $1,800 | $9,600 |
| Honolulu 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,630 | $3,250 | $10,000+ |
| Honolulu 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,714 | $4,350 | $10,000+ |
| Honolulu 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,887 | $1,300 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Honolulu
What type of rentals are currently available in Honolulu?
There are currently 3327 Apartments for Rent in Honolulu, HI with pricing that ranges from $790 to $31,156. There are also 614 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Honolulu ranging from $900 to $17,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Honolulu?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Honolulu ranges from $900 to $17,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,746.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Honolulu?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Honolulu range from $1,095 to $31,156,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,800 to $9,600.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,250 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,575.
